Unveiling the Parent Company: HelloFresh SE

To understand the relationship between Home Chef and EveryPlate, it’s crucial to acknowledge their shared parent company: HelloFresh SE. This global giant, headquartered in Berlin, Germany, is a publicly traded company and a major player in the meal kit industry worldwide. HelloFresh SE acquired Home Chef in 2018, adding it to its growing portfolio of brands. EveryPlate was already part of the HelloFresh family, having been launched as their value-focused offering.

HelloFresh SE operates multiple meal kit brands catering to different consumer segments. This strategy allows the company to capture a larger share of the market by offering options that appeal to varying budgets, dietary preferences, and culinary skill levels. Understanding this umbrella structure clarifies why similarities exist between Home Chef and EveryPlate, as they benefit from shared resources and infrastructure within the HelloFresh organization.

Home Chef: A Deeper Dive into Customization and Variety

Home Chef is generally positioned as a meal kit service that prioritizes customization and a broader range of meal options. While convenience is still a key factor, Home Chef emphasizes providing customers with the ability to tailor their meals to their liking. This is achieved through various features:

The “Customize It” Option

A hallmark of Home Chef is its “Customize It” feature, which allows subscribers to swap proteins in select meals. For example, a meal featuring chicken might offer the option to substitute steak or salmon, often at an additional cost. This level of flexibility is a significant draw for those with specific dietary preferences or simply seeking more control over their meals. This added feature allows consumers to adjust their calorie intake, nutritional value, and flavor profiles according to their unique requirements.

Menu Variety and Complexity

Home Chef typically offers a wider selection of recipes each week compared to EveryPlate. These recipes often include more complex preparations and feature a greater variety of ingredients. You’ll find meals inspired by cuisines from around the world, as well as options catering to different dietary needs, such as vegetarian, carb-conscious, and calorie-conscious choices.

The focus on variety extends to different meal formats. Beyond traditional meal kits, Home Chef offers Oven-Ready meals, which require minimal preparation, as well as Fast & Fresh options designed for quick cooking times. They also provide Culinary Collection meals, which feature premium ingredients and more elaborate recipes for a gourmet cooking experience. This expanded range accommodates individuals with hectic schedules and diverse cooking aptitudes.

Price Point and Target Audience

The increased customization and variety offered by Home Chef naturally translate to a higher price point per serving compared to EveryPlate. Home Chef targets individuals and families who are willing to pay a premium for greater flexibility, higher-quality ingredients, and a wider selection of meal options. The target demographic is often willing to invest more in their culinary experiences.

EveryPlate: Affordable Meal Kits Without Sacrificing Taste

EveryPlate distinguishes itself as the budget-friendly option within the HelloFresh SE family. The focus is on providing affordable, straightforward meal kits that simplify the cooking process without compromising on flavor.

Simplified Recipes and Ingredient Lists

EveryPlate recipes are designed to be easy to follow and require minimal cooking skills. The ingredient lists are typically shorter than those found in Home Chef meals, and the preparation steps are streamlined to reduce cooking time. This simplicity makes EveryPlate an excellent choice for beginners or those seeking quick and easy weeknight meals.

Limited Customization Options

In contrast to Home Chef, EveryPlate offers limited customization options. While you can select your meals from a weekly menu, the ability to swap proteins or modify ingredients is generally not available. This limited flexibility is a trade-off for the lower price point. This simplicity benefits from reduced complexity.

Menu Focus and Variety

While EveryPlate offers a variety of meals each week, the selection is typically smaller than that of Home Chef. The meals tend to be more familiar and approachable, focusing on classic comfort food dishes and family favorites. While you’ll still find some international-inspired recipes, the overall emphasis is on simple, satisfying meals that appeal to a broad range of tastes.

The Affordability Factor

EveryPlate’s primary selling point is its affordability. By streamlining recipes, minimizing ingredient complexity, and reducing customization options, EveryPlate can offer meal kits at a significantly lower price per serving compared to other meal kit services, including Home Chef. This makes it an attractive option for budget-conscious consumers, students, and families looking to save money on groceries.

Is Home Chef owned by EveryPlate?

Both Home Chef and EveryPlate are not owned by each other in a direct, parent-subsidiary relationship. They are, however, sister companies operating under the same parent company umbrella: HelloFresh SE. This means that while they function independently with distinct branding, menu offerings, and pricing strategies, they ultimately answer to the same corporate leadership and shareholders.

This shared ownership structure allows HelloFresh SE to capture a wider range of the meal kit market. EveryPlate targets the budget-conscious consumer, while Home Chef caters to those seeking greater customization and higher-end ingredients. This diversified approach maximizes market penetration and overall revenue for the parent company.

What is the relationship between HelloFresh, Home Chef, and EveryPlate?

HelloFresh is the parent company of both Home Chef and EveryPlate. Think of HelloFresh as the corporation that owns and operates both Home Chef and EveryPlate as separate brands. Each brand operates with its own business model and target market.

Essentially, HelloFresh designed EveryPlate to compete with cheaper meal kits. At the same time, they acquired Home Chef to offer a more premium experience. This allows HelloFresh to appeal to various customers with different budgets and preferences.

Will canceling my Home Chef subscription also cancel my EveryPlate subscription?

No, canceling your Home Chef subscription will not automatically cancel your EveryPlate subscription, or vice versa. Because they operate as separate entities under the HelloFresh SE umbrella, each service requires independent management of subscriptions.

You must cancel each subscription individually through its respective website or mobile app. Canceling one does not affect the other, even though you may find similarities in account management processes due to their shared corporate structure.
